List of Cards
Warp Control (BOOST) Next time you step on a warp panel, you are allowed to decide which warp panel to teleport to. Theme: Cook reading the wind.
My Wild Friends (BOOST) (Max 1). Summon a friendly Wild Unit unit onto the board and heal it to full. The summon will automatically engage enemies and can gain stars on winning, giving half of the stars gained to the summoner. Theme: Teotoratta playing with wild animals.
Contest of Cuteness (BATTLE) (Max 1). The battle is decided by whoever has the highest cuteness. The winner steals stars equal to 5x the loser's level. Cuteness = 11 - (HP + ATK-EVD) Theme: Sham and Saki striking their cute poses in competition with each other.
Rebellion (EVENT) For 3 chapters, every other player will receive +1 ATK, +1 DEF and +1 EVD when fighting the player currently in first place. Theme: Free theme related to Flying Red Barrel.
Bank of Poppo (TRAP) First person to land on this card loses Lvl x 10 stars. The second person to land on this card gains the lost stars. Theme: Featuring a cash card with a Poppo logo on it.
Nanako's Bit (GIFT) (Max 1). Randomly receive +1 ATK, DEF or EVD the start of battle while this card is held, and lose 7 stars. This card is discarded upon KO or use. Theme: Another character using Nanako's Bit for something.

Welcome to the festivities! We're happy to announce a big celebration for 100% Orange Juice hitting 2 million game + DLC downloads thanks to all of your support!
During the 1 million download celebration we added a free new unit, Mio, to the game, and... you guessed it!
A new unit, Mio (Festive) is now available to all owners of Mio! To unlock her, you need to have played 5 games as Mio, and then clear the new Extra Mission, "Secret Santa", on normal or higher difficulty, while playing as Mio.
Izawa Shiori (Nanachi in "Made in Abyss", Pochita in "Chainsaw Man", Kafuru in "Senran Kagura") reprises her role as the wonderful voice for Mio (Festive)!
Her hyper is illustrated by Senca, and special card by Yulay Devlet!
Please enjoy getting rowdy with her!
Voices Have Been Liberated!
As the second major announcement, all character voices are now available for free to all players!
You no longer need to own the DLC to enjoy the characters' banter, even if you only own the base game and nothing more! This is something we've wanted to do for a long time to make the experience better for everyone, and after a lot of thought it's finally been implemented!
All base game's character announcers are also available for everyone, to give you a wide selection of great announcers! DLC characters' announcer voices are only available for owners of the DLC (apart from free character rotation).
As a result, we are retiring the following 3 DLC from the Steam store:
Starter Character Voice Pack
Core Voice Pack 1
Core Voice Pack 2
While you can no longer buy these 3 DLC soon (currently pending Steam removal), they continue giving direct unlock of the characters whose voices they contain, which otherwise can be unlocked by playing normally. In addition, to compensate everyone who's bought these DLC over the years, each of the DLC gives their owner a consumable item (so up to 3 total for owners of all DLC), which can be exchanged for either 500 oranges or 10.000 stars each in the in-game Shop!
Please note that there's a limit of 999 Oranges and 99.999 Stars that can held at once, so as to not waste your tokens!
In addition, the Game of the Year Every Year Edition has been updated to contain Pudding Pack, Breaker Pack and Wanderer Pack instead of the 3 voice packs, keeping its nominal value the same.

The long-awaited beta for the updated Bounty Hunt is here! Read below on instructions on how to opt in!
This time we are running the beta in two 2-week phases. The first one is now live! After the first beta period, we will collect feedback to implement potential phases for a 2nd phase before the eventual release into live version.
Changes
Starting with some of the core questing changes! Location shuffle now takes place every 7 chapters. In addition, a new Forecast button lets you preview where the field locations will move upon next shuffle. Further, after losing a bounty fight, players can rechallenge the bounty upon recovery, instead of moving. Passing a quest location while having duplicates of the same quest contract will now grant only one item instead of as many copies as the duplicate contracts you had.
New perks! Upon each Norma level up, players can choose one of 3 perks to permanently improve their stats or grant other bonuses.
These changes are intended to give players a clearer path of progression toward being able to take down harder bounties at higher levels, while making simple quest gathering a less efficient way to play the entire game.
A new PvP bounty system has been added! Defeating another player gives the players the Assassin's Badge item, which allows picking up Player Bounties from home panels. These bounties are hidden from other players. In addition, a public bounty is issued for such scoundrels, with a bounty that goes up for every KO they inflict, and which can be claimed by anyone who defeats them.
A new invader has been added: Lost Rogue! This dangerous new foe may be easier to defeat on paper, but the attempt carries great risk! Players may choose a specific invader, or leave it to be random from lobby options.
New items, and lots and lots of item rebalancing! Combat sweets now last for X battles, instead of X chapters, and are placed in the player's inventory upon purchase. They can be activated from there at will. Shop prices are now adjusted for some characters individually, rather than simply based on their stats.
A new special shop has been added: Shady Merchant. This elusive merchant may appear and offer you their powerful wares at high cost.

How to Join
To participate, go to the properties of 100% Orange Juice in your Steam Library, then BETAS page -> select "beta - Public Beta" from the dropdown menu.
Progress in the beta version is separate from your main save and will not interfere with that when you return to the normal game build.
